Miwa Matreyek

This World Made Itself & Myth and Infrastructure
Miwa Matreyek is an animator, director, designer, and performer based in Los Angeles.
Coming from a background in animation by way of collage, Miwa Matreyek creates live, staged performances where she interacts with her animations as a shadow silhouette, at the cross section of cinematic and theatrical, fantastical and tangible, illusionistic and physical. Her work exists in a dreamlike visual space that makes invisible worlds visible, often weaving surreal and poetic narratives of conflict between man and nature. Her work exists both at the realm of the hand-made and tech. She travels as a one woman show, often incorporating artist talks and workshops.
